- 博客(32)
- 收藏
- 关注
转载 MySQL和oracle的常用引擎介绍
MySQL:在MySQL数据库中,常用的引擎主要就是2个:Innodb和MyIASM。1.简单介绍这两种引擎,以及该如何去选择a.Innodb引擎,Innodb引擎提供了对数据库ACID事务的支持。并且还提供了行级锁和外键的约束。它的设计的目标就是处理大数据容量的数据库系统。它本身实际上是基于Mysql后台的完整的系统。Mysql运行的时候,Innodb会在内存中建立缓冲池,用于缓冲数据和索...
2019-07-24 23:03:26
1365
转载 IDEA 创建springboot项目和springcloud项目方法
https://blog.youkuaiyun.com/zhanglei500038/article/details/81018123
2018-08-29 12:04:17
1550
转载 maven 配置参数说明
原文地址 http://www.cnblogs.com/panxuejun/p/6184072.html这是一篇很不错的关于maven 配置参数说明的文章,理论与实际结合,通俗易懂,所以我转了!groupId :the unique identifier of the organization or group that created the project artifactId :...
2018-08-27 10:05:47
680
原创 jackson Serialize 序列化时使用属性名 不使用 get set 获取的字段名
在序列化的时候,有时被序列化的对象 里面的字段 和get,set方法对应的不一样,但是序列化的时候希望出现”name”:”xxx” 而不是 “studentName”:”xxx” json串。”如下:class Student{ private String name; private int age; public String getStudentName(...
2018-06-14 17:36:26
7424
原创 cfx 开发 jackson 自定义json 的序列化和与反序列化 配置
第一步:maven 引用<dependency> <groupId>org.codehaus.jackson</groupId> <artifactId>jackson-jaxrs</artifactId> <version>1.9.13</version></dep
2018-05-10 17:01:19
1329
转载 java lambda
摘要:此篇文章主要介绍 Java8 Lambda 表达式产生的背景和用法,以及 Lambda 表达式与匿名类的不同等。本文系 OneAPM 工程师编译整理。Java 是一流的面向对象语言,除了部分简单数据类型,Java 中的一切都是对象,即使数组也是一种对象,每个类创建的实例也是对象。在 Java 中定义的函数或方法不可能完全独立,也不能将方法作为参数或返回一个方法给实例。从 Swing 开始,我...
2018-05-04 14:29:30
601
转载 通透Gson@Expose注解、@SerializedName、解析json数据
https://blog.youkuaiyun.com/andywuchuanlong/article/details/44077913
2018-03-27 10:43:39
802
转载 nginx 正向 反向 代理,负载均衡
系统环境:VirtualBox ManagerCentos6.4nginx1.10.0IP对应的机器名: IP 机器名 角色名10.0.0.139 [elk] client10.0.0.136 [lvs-master] nginx server10.0.0....
2018-02-02 19:32:28
424
转载 手机号码归属地查询接口大全
淘宝网 API地址: http://tcc.taobao.com/cc/json/mobile_tel_segment.htm?tel=15850781443 参数: tel:手机号码 返回:JSON 拍拍 API地址: http://virtual.paipai.com/extinfo/GetMobileProductInfo?mobile=158507814
2018-02-02 11:15:26
5420
转载 sql case
case具有两种格式。简单case函数和case搜索函数。[sql] view plain copy print?"font-size:14px;">--简单case函数 case sex when '1' then '男' when '2' then '女’ else '其他' end --case
2017-12-20 09:56:57
326
转载 java8 新特性
1.简介毫无疑问,Java 8是自Java 5(2004年)发布以来Java语言最大的一次版本升级,如果不学习,你会怀疑自己面前的代码是不是Java。Java 8带来了很多的新特性,比如编译器、类库、开发工具和JVM(Java虚拟机),但最最主要的还是函数式编程。接下来将会结合代码去展示Java 8的新特性。下面主要介绍Java 8的最显著特性:接口增强Lamb
2017-12-07 19:23:25
345
转载 应用系统之间数据传输的几种方式
随着近年来SOA(面向服务技术架构)的兴起,越来越多的应用系统开始进行分布式的设计和部署。系统由原来单一的技术架构变成面向服务的多系统架构。原来在一个系统之间可以完成的业务流程,通过多系统的之间多次交互来实现。这里不打算介绍如何进行SOA架构的设计,而是介绍一下应用系统之间如何进行数据的传输。应用系统之间数据传输有三个要素:传输方式,传输协议,数据格式数据传输方式一般无非是以下几种
2017-12-07 19:01:31
1022
转载 java Collection.sort
第一种方法,Bean中实现Comparator接口 public class CollectionsClass { /** * @param args */ public static void main(String[] args) { List list = new ArrayList(); //Be
2017-11-27 14:05:52
599
转载 Linux服务器之间拷贝文件(提示connect to host localhost port 22: Connection refused lost )
Li 因服务器割接,所以我要将一台服务上的文件拷贝到另一台服务器上。我是Linux菜鸟就会一些简单命令。因两台服务器都在内网,所以我想使用scp命令,这里我前把命令贴出,下面在补上我遇到的问题。 Java代码 #第一种方式从本地拷贝到另一台服务器(A--->B) scp -P 13022 -r /home/cstdev/wom_2
2017-09-20 21:02:06
2000
转载 java 线程池
以下是本文的目录大纲:一.Java中的ThreadPoolExecutor类二.深入剖析线程池实现原理三.使用示例四.如何合理配置线程池的大小若有不正之处请多多谅解,并欢迎批评指正。一.Java中的ThreadPoolExecutor类java.uitl.concurrent.ThreadPoolExecutor类是线程池中最核心的一个类,因
2017-08-02 23:15:52
311
转载 String、StringBuffer与StringBuilder之间区别
1.三者在执行速度方面的比较:StringBuilder > StringBuffer > String 2.String 的原因 String:字符串常量 StringBuffer:字符创变量 StringBuilder:字符创变量 从上面的名字可以看到,String是“字符创常量”,也就是不可改变的对象。对于这句话的理解你
2017-06-28 10:52:25
235
转载 JMS(java message service)java消息服务
什么是JMSJMS(Java Message Service) 即Java消息服务。它提供标准的产生、发送、接收消息的接口简化企业 应用的开发。它是J2EE规范的一部分,定义的接口标准,针对不同的厂商有不同的实现库。JMS原型JMS的原型是以MOM为基准, 进行组件的。 程序A 是消息生产者, 将消息发送到 MOM 服务器。程序B是消息消费者,负责从MOM服务器(队列服务器
2017-06-26 16:00:23
472
转载 org.apache.struts2.json.JSONException: java.lang.reflect.InvocationTargetException异常解决
org.apache.struts2.json.JSONException: java.lang.reflect.InvocationTargetException org.apache.struts2.json.JSONWriter.bean(JSONWriter.java:246) org.apache.struts2.json.JSONWriter.processCustom(JSONW
2017-04-10 17:20:47
854
转载 html table 边框设置
【HTML】Table边框使用总结 ,只显示你要显示的边框(内边框,外边框)(2013-07-18 22:04:15)转载▼标签: table border 边框 去掉 表格 分类: js/div/css/html一、表格的常用属性基本属性有:width(宽度)、
2017-03-10 15:54:03
1291
转载 mysql 字符串替换
首先描述一下,我遇到的问题:以下是数据库中的一个表data:语言栏是这样的english(???) 我相报括号以及括号中的字符去掉 replace函数是不支持正则表达式的,所以只能采用其他的方法处理。:上网查了一下 我用了下面的sql[sql] view plain copy print?update da
2017-03-09 11:18:28
1524
转载 java 解析json字符串
{ "cityInfo": [ { "cityId": "001", "cityName": "嘉兴" }, { "cityId": "002", "cityName": "宁波"
2017-02-22 09:07:01
368
转载 java插件开发
假设一个photoshop工程,对照片可以有很多种风格效果的装饰,有一些装饰效果photoshop开发组可以自己开发并且放在发布版本里面发布。那么大家都可以使用这种效果。但是如果用户想开发自己的装饰效果怎么办? 难道跑到ps开发组去,把自己的代码给人家,让人家把自己的代码放进人家的ps大工程里面,编译然后发布到下面一个新的发布版本里面吗,公布给社会嘛?如果人家不同意怎么办? 那自己开发的岂不是白费
2017-01-10 17:33:38
571
转载 java之线程池
原作者:海子 出处:http://www.cnblogs.com/dolphin0520/ 本文归作者海子和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。 在前面的文章中,我们使用线程的时候就去创建一个线程,这样实现起来非常简便,但是就会有一个问题: 如果并发的线程数量很多,并
2017-01-08 17:12:26
294
转载 Java序列化与反序列化
Java序列化与反序列化是什么?为什么需要序列化与反序列化?如何实现Java序列化与反序列化?本文围绕这些问题进行了探讨。 1.Java序列化与反序列化 Java序列化是指把Java对象转换为字节序列的过程;而Java反序列化是指把字节序列恢复为Java对象的过程。 2.为什么需要序列化与反序列化 我们知道,当两个进程进行远程通信时,可以相互发送各种类型的数据,包括
2017-01-03 16:22:40
300
转载 avax.servlet.jsp.JspException cannot be resolved to a type
javax.servlet.jsp.JspException cannot be resolved to a type当在项目中报错为:javax.servlet.jsp.*时,这时说明需要jsp-api.jar。如果报错信息为:javax.servlet.http.*时,这时说明需要servlet-api.jar这两个包在tomcat的安装目录下的
2016-12-12 14:47:45
1405
转载 eclipse maven plugin 插件 安装 和 配置
eclipse maven plugin 插件 安装 和 配置离线插件点击下载离线安装包:eclipse-maven-plugin.zip ( for eclipse helios or higher ) 。解压缩到任意目录(如这里的plugins目录):目录路径最好不要含有中文或空格。以下用 %maven-plugin% 表示插件解压缩的根目录。如这里的 E:/setup
2016-12-08 22:12:07
376
转载 XX cannot be resolved to a type 报错
"XX cannot be resolved to a type "eclipse报错及解决说明 引言: eclipse新导入的项目经常可以看到“XX cannot be resolved to a type”的报错信息。本文将做以简单总结。 正文: (1)jdk不匹配(或不存在) 项目指定的jdk为“jdk1.6.0_18”,而当前ec
2016-12-08 10:49:01
791
转载 eclipce 一直在buildingworkspace
Eclipse 一直Building Workspace 的解决办法 2014-06-27 09:51:09| 分类: 专业-工具类|举报|字号 订阅 下载LOFTER我的照片书 |Eclipse 一直不停 building workspa
2016-12-07 21:58:20
484
转载 eclipce创建maven项目
Eclipse+Maven创建webapp项目1、开启eclipse,右键new——》other,如下图找到maven project2、选择maven project,显示创建maven项目的窗口,勾选如图所示,Create a simple project3、输入maven项目的基本信息,如下图所示:4、完成maven项目的创建,生成相应
2016-12-06 16:02:26
1290
转载 SVN 冲突解决办法
【SVN多用户开发】代码冲突&解决办法SVN是一款集中式的代码存储工具,可以帮助多个用户协同开发同一应用程序。但是SVN不能完全代替人工操作,有时也需要程序员自己进行沟通确认有效的代码。下面就简单的看一下,常见的代码冲突以及解决方法。总结起来,无非是: 1 避免开发人员共同开发同一文件 2 开发前需要时常更新本地代码库
2016-11-23 14:34:05
624
转载 tar/jar/war包的区别
tar:tar是*nix下的打包工具,生成的包通常也用tar作为扩展名,其实tar只是负责打包,不一定有压缩,事实上可以压缩,也可以不压缩,通常你看到xxxx.tar.gz,就表示这个tar包是压缩的,并且使用的压缩算法是GNU ZIP,而xxxx.tar.bz2就表示这个包使用了bzip2算法进行压缩,当然这样的命名只是一种惯例,并非强制。简单地说,tar就仅是打包。jar:即Java
2016-11-09 14:41:34
1304
转载 Java Logger(java日志)
目录1. 简介2. 安装3. log4j基本概念3.1. Logger3.2. Appender3.2.1. 使用ConsoleAppender3.2.2. 使用FileAppender3.2.3. 使用WriterAppender3.3. Layout3.4. 基本示例3.4.1. SimpleLayout和FileAppender3.4.2.
2016-11-09 10:04:42
1194
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人